Avery Dennison Corporation (NYSE: AVY) is a global materials science and digital identification solutions company. We are Making Possible™ products and solutions that help advance the industries we serve, providing branding and information solutions that optimize labor and supply chain efficiency, reduce waste, advance sustainability, circularity and transparency, and better connect brands and consumers. We design and develop labeling and functional materials, radio-frequency identification (RFID) inlays and tags, software applications that connect the physical and digital, and offerings that enhance branded packaging and carry or display information that improves the customer experience. Serving industries worldwide — including home and personal care, apparel, general retail, e-commerce, logistics, food and grocery, pharmaceuticals and automotive — we employ approximately 35,000 employees in more than 50 countries. Our reported sales in 2024 were $8.8 billion. Learn more at www.averydennison.com.

Job Description

Avery Dennison, Label and Graphic Materials is seeking a Quality Supervisor to join the Divisional Quality Team in our headquarters office in Mentor, Ohio. The Supervisor will lead and provide direction to a team of Customer Quality Admins and Analysts to deliver world class quality services for Avery Dennison Customers internally and externally.  The primary goals include driving Employee Engagement, Safety, Customer Service, product quality and claims process improvements. This role reports to the Sr. Divisional Quality Manager.

 

Activities may include, but are not limited to:

  • Team leadership in performance planning and career development 

    • Establish goals, track performance and provide feedback with minimal guidance for team of Quality Admins and Analysts leading claim investigation 

    • Adjust resourcing as required to deliver results which may include posting and hiring new roles 

    • Perform general management duties, exercising usual authority concerning Team, performance appraisals, promotions and performance management. Responsible for training and development employees, estimating resource/labor needs, assigning work, meeting completion dates, interpreting and ensuring consistent application of organizational policies. 

    • Develop and maintain a succession plan for your Team

  • Leading the team to achieve the Quality Team Mission and Goals 

    • Prepare and communicate and interpret  metrics / results weekly and monthly 

    • Audit claim entries to ensure accuracy for proper claim investigation 

    • Drive step change improvements in leading and lagging metrics including response times, claim entry time, claim closure time, claim cycle time, and OPLH (resources required to process claims)

  • Improving the Overall Customer Experience 

    • Speak directly with Customers to ensure a positive Customer experience during claim processing and to gain feedback on our processes and their experience. 

    • Take action to address opportunities for improvement with customer interactions from feedback in the external survey or internally with Sales partners

    • Lead improvements as a team addressing specific focus areas measured in the customer survey key performance indicators

  • Supporting the team in daily claim processing 

    • Manage the overall resourcing workload of the team - pull triggers to adjust team responsibilities to balance capacity 

    • Lead and improve our Management for Daily Improvement (MDI) and other lean sigma tools and processes.

    • Maintain the group email, group voicemail, mailroom process and other various claim sample handling processes

    • Develop and lead a training process within the team ensuring there is a cross training matrix maintained on the team for back ups 

    • Maintain the working ‘Dashboard’ for the team’s key performance indicators

    • Lead and resolve claim related issues with Customers, Sales leaders, Marketing, Customer Service, Manufacturing plants and suppliers

    • Perform data analysis, lot trace and containment activities

    • Create, implement and/or update and maintain critical work instructions and controlled documents to ensure consistent claim processing 

  • Leading initiatives to improve overall Claims processing 

    • Complete data analysis to determine root cause and to identify priority projects.

    • Act as the escalation point to support and manage as a back up the end to end claims process 

    • When required work directly in the system to, complete claim entry, investigations such as lot trace to bring claims to closure
